The new Varlink brochure, which is split into five main sectors – namely handheld terminals, tablet PCs, printers, barcode scanners and EPoS products – not only offers dedicated pages to each brand, it also introduces a matrix system to highlight product positioning in a selection of key market areas.
The new methodology educates resellers on which products are most suited to each sector, ensuring that future product selection represents the task at hand.
Since the last brochure release, Varlink and EPoS Distributor have expanded their portfolios to include Honeywell’s rugged mobile computers, barcode scanners and vehicle mounts, PTS rapid app generator software, SOTI mobility management for Enterprise, Extricom wireless LAN systems and Q-Guide customer experience enhancement solutions, to name just a few. Each of these new additions takes Varlink to a wider audience and allows them to enter new markets.
Innovative new product developments from established brands within the Varlink and EPoS Distributor range include; the exclusive to Varlink BrotherTD-2000 series of desktop mobile label and receipt printers which have a touch panel keypad and battery base unit which allow for flexibility on the move; MioWORK’s range of six-inch Android tablet pcs which offer a pocket-sized solution bridging the gap between Smartphones and full sized tablet PC.
In addition to this, Posiflex have recently launched their new sleek and stylish XT range which encompasses Bezel-free technology with Intel i3, i5 and i7 processing power. The terminals are flexible and elegant without compromising on performance.
